s2(
4)
(
b
) occupier can avoid liability for
injuries
/damage suffered by C when caused by
negligence
of independent
contractor
occupier must prove
3
things
must have been
reasonable
for occupier to have
entrusted
their work to an independent contractor (
haseldine
v
daw
&
son
)
2. contractor hired must be
competent
to carry out the task (
bottomley
v
todmorden
cricket club)
3. if possible occupier must
inspect
the work (
woodward
v
major
of
hastings
)
